Last night, the Rochester Americans lost their seventh straight game to the Albany River Rats in a 3-2 loss. The Amerks had a fairly good start with a great goal from Rob Globke with assists from Clarke MacArthur and Marek Zagrapan at 4:44 in the first period. The period ended with the Amerks up 1-0. Last night’s game was anything but, pretty for the Rochester Americans as they lost 5-1 to the Rockford IceHogs. The Amerks played a pretty solid first period with Clarke MacArthur scoring his 9th goal of the season on the powerplay at 17:38 to take the lead 1-0 going into the first intermission.
